CVE-2019-15638
CVE-2019-15638 is a high-severity vulnerability in Copadata Zenon with a CVSS 3.x base score of 7.8.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-427.

Description
COPA-DATA zenone32 zenon Editor through 8.10 has an Uncontrolled Search Path Element.
